Linda has been very busy....

Those of you who aren't Facebook friends with me or Linda may not be aware of what has been going on with her art.

Last month she had an opening at Bellas Artes (the premier museum in San Miguel). It is still up until April 23. The subject is women and architecture.


It was very well reviewed in the Atencion, our local English language newspaper. 



Linda was interviewed and a short video is showing in the entry to the gallery. The video can be viewed on Youtube.

Then, Linda was also interviewed by Sheila Sabine, who interviews artists who live in interesting homes. See the interview by clicking on this link.

Finally, this week Linda is one of the prime movers of a show called Nasty Women, where works by many San Miguel artists are being sold for $100 each, with proceeds going to several local charities - CASA and Mujeres en Cambio.
